Barbara Boyd discusses Donald Trump's multifaceted approach to eradicating the pervasive drug trade, which is critical to reviving America's economic and social fabric.
Boyd highlights Trump's use of military action, financial tactics, and strategic appointments of key figures like Robert F. Kennedy Jr. to combat drug cartels, foreign terrorist organizations, and the influence of the British financial empire.
She provides historical context, discussing how drugs have been used as tools of subversion, and outlines the new national defense strategy prioritizing the Western hemisphere.
